How Often Do You Need to Change Your Oil?
How often should car owners be changing their oil? This is a common concern for both car enthusiasts and regular drivers. Generally, manufacturers recommend changing engine oil every 5,000 to 7,500 miles, although some modern vehicles can stretch this interval to 10,000 miles or more under specific conditions. Factors influencing oil change frequency include driving habits, climate, and the type of oil used. For instance, those who frequently engage in stop-and-go traffic or drive in extreme temperatures may require more frequent changes. Additionally, synthetic oils tend to provide better protection and can extend intervals between changes. Monitoring the oil level and quality is vital; dark, gritty oil indicates it's time for a change. What's Included in a Full Service Oil Change?
A thorough full oil change usually covers multiple critical aspects intended to ensure maximum engine efficiency. First, the procedure involves removing the used engine oil, which is then replaced with premium, manufacturer-approved oil. The oil filter is also replaced to guarantee that contaminants do not circulate within the engine.
In addition to these core responsibilities, service professionals typically carry out a multi-point inspection, examining hoses, belts, and fluid levels for deterioration and damage. They may also inspect the engine air filter and cabin air filter, swapping them out when needed.
Some auto shops supply extra services, such as tyre rotation, brake examination, and even a wash or clean of the car's interior, enhancing the overall upkeep of the vehicle. This comprehensive strategy not only preserves engine condition but also aids in the durability of other essential systems within the automobile.

Identifying When It Is Time for Your Next Full Service Oil Change
How often should vehicle owners plan their next comprehensive oil change appointment? Generally, it is recommended every 3,000 to 7,500 miles, based on the specific make and model of the vehicle and the oil type utilized. Regularly checking the vehicle's oil level and quality is vital; if the oil appears dark or gritty, it may indicate the need for a change sooner. Additionally, owners should take note of the vehicle's performance. Odd noises, lower fuel economy, or illuminated dashboard lights may be signs that an oil change is overdue. Changes in season can influence how frequently oil changes are needed; to illustrate, extreme cold weather during winter months can demand more frequent oil change intervals. In closing, reviewing the owner's manual delivers personalized guidance suited to the vehicle, promoting top performance and durability. What Kind of Oil Is Used in a Full Service Oil Change?
Usually, a full service oil change uses either conventional, semi-synthetic, or fully synthetic oil. The selection is determined by the vehicle's requirements and the owner's preferences, ensuring maximum performance and engine preservation while driving.
How Long Does a Full Service Oil Change Take?
A comprehensive oil change generally needs between half an hour to an hour, based on the shop's speed and supplementary services included. Factors like car model and oil preference can additionally impact the length of the service.
